Wed, 5 Jun 2013Chicago-based recruitment process outsourcing (RPO) firm PeopleScout has been selected by retail giant Walmart as a recruitment partner to help hire 100,000 veterans over the next five years.

In addition to the RPO engagement, the firms are partnering to launch a talent exchange to match veterans with job opportunities at Walmart and other “leading companies”, PeopleScout says.

PeopleScout is part of the broader outsourcing and recruiting company SeatonCorp.

More information on the ex-military recruitment project, originally announced in January, is available through Walmart’s dedicated Careers with a Mission web page.
